The first major plantings of cherries in Door County reached maturity just before WWI and hundreds of migrant workers were recruited to the area as cherry pickers during the months of July and August.  Cherries continued to be hand-picked until replaced by the cherry shaker, a cherry picking machine, in the early 1960s.
